@@ -28,6 +28,15 @@ class WebSocketDispatcherHost : public BrowserMessageFilter {
public:
typedef base::Callback<net::URLRequestContext*()> GetRequestContextCallback;
+ // Return value for methods that may delete the WebSocketHost. This enum is
+ // binary-compatible with net::WebSocketEventInterface::ChannelState, to make
+ // conversion cheap. By using a separate enum including net/ header files can
+ // be avoided.
+ enum WebSocketHostState {
+ WEBSOCKET_HOST_ALIVE,
+ WEBSOCKET_HOST_DELETED
+ };
+
explicit WebSocketDispatcherHost(
const GetRequestContextCallback& get_context_callback);
@@ -37,30 +46,34 @@ class WebSocketDispatcherHost : public BrowserMessageFilter {
// The following methods are used by WebSocketHost::EventInterface to send
// IPCs from the browser to the renderer or child process. Any of them may
- // delete the WebSocketHost on failure, leading to the WebSocketChannel and
- // EventInterface also being deleted.
+ // return WEBSOCKET_HOST_DELETED and delete the WebSocketHost on failure,
+ // leading to the WebSocketChannel and EventInterface also being deleted.
// Sends a WebSocketMsg_AddChannelResponse IPC, and then deletes and
// unregisters the WebSocketHost if |fail| is true.
- void SendAddChannelResponse(int routing_id,
- bool fail,
- const std::string& selected_protocol,
- const std::string& extensions);
+ WebSocketHostState SendAddChannelResponse(
